  • Purpose: Isolated acetabular fractures can occur as a result of a high energy impact on the hip joint. Surgery is required for most patients with an isolated acetabular fracture in order to alleviate pain, restore joint stability, and regain hip function. This study was conducted in order to examine the course of hip function in patients after surgical treatment of an isolated traumatic acetabular fracture. Materials and Methods: This prospective series of consecutive cases included patients who underwent surgery for treatment of an isolated acetabular fracture in a European level one trauma center between 2016 and 2020. Patients with relevant concomitant injuries were excluded. Scoring of hip function was performed by a trauma surgeon using the Modified Merle d'Aubigné and Postel score at six-week, 12-week, six-month, and one-year follow-up. Scores between 3-11 indicate poor, 12-14 fair, 15-17 good, and 18 excellent hip function. Results: Data on 46 patients were included. The mean score for hip function was 10 (95% confidence interval [CI] 7.09-12.91) at six-week follow-up (23 patients), 13.75 (95% CI 10.74-16.76) at 12-week follow-up (28 patients), 16 (95% CI 13.40-18.60) at six-month follow-up (25 patients), and 15.50 (95% CI 10.55-20.45) at one-year follow-up (17 patients). After one-year follow-up, the scores reflected an excellent outcome in 11 patients, good in five patients, and poor in one patient. Conclusion: This study reports on the course of hip function in patients who have undergone surgical treatment for isolated acetabular fractures. Restoration of excellent hip function takes six months.

  • The purpose of this study is to report the effect of korean medicine treatment for developmental dysplasia of the hip (DDH) in adults. A patient diagnosed with DDH had been treated with acupuncture, electroacupuncture, cupping therapy and chuna manual therapy for 8 weeks. The patient was evaluated by using range of motion (ROM) of hip joint, muscle strength of lower extremity, leg length, numeric rating scale (NRS) and Korean version of hip disability and osteoarthritis outcome score (K-HOOS). After the treatment, the patient had an improvement in the symptoms, pain, and activities of daily living of K-HOOS, especially the quality of life. In addition, NRS decreased from 7 to 4 points, and ROM and muscle strength also improved. The results of this study show that korean medicine treatment is effective and meaningful as one of the conservative treatment for DDH in adults.

  • Developmental dysplasia of the hip broadly includes inadequate development of the hip joint involving the acetabulum or proximal femur, or both. Although ultrasonographic studies in neonates have greatly lowered the frequency of neglected or operatively treated cases, its sensitivity is less than desired. Hip dysplasia without subluxation is commonly diagnosed incidentally and strongly related to degenerative arthritis in females after the 4th decade. Hip dysplasia with subluxation shows symptoms through various periods, depending on its severity, especially for women with onset during pregnancy. A complete physical examination and early treatment for neonates are extremely important for obtaining satisfactory outcomes. To avoid underdiagnosis and to serve appropriate treatment on time, the authors recommend examining any suspicious hips in infants under two years of age. The study will discuss the diagnosis and primary treatment of developmental dysplasia of the hip.

  • The increase in the number of primary total hip arthroplasties that will be performed over the next several decades will lead to an increase in the incidence of periprosthetic fractures around the femoral stem. A search of targeted articles was conducted using on-line databases of PubMed (National Library of Medicine) and articles were obtained from January 2008 to November 2021. Reliable prediction of treatment can be achieved using the Vancouver classification; internal fixation is indicated in fractures involving a stable implant and revision arthroplasty is indicated in those with unstable prostheses. To the best of our knowledge, relatively fewer studies regarding periprosthetic proximal femur fractures of cemented stems have been reported. The focus of this review is on the risk factors and strategies for treatment of these fractures for periprosthetic femoral fractures around a cemented hip arthroplasty.

  • Study of east & west medical science documentary records of Hip joint pain lead to following conclusions. 1. Easten medicine classify hip joint pain with terms "Bi-chu-tong", "Bi chu in tong" "Bi-chu-choong-tong". 2. Easten medicine asorts cause of hip joint pain with external factor, such as exogenous energy, six yin evil energy and intrinsic factor, which are weakness caused by prolonged deasease, warm-heat evil. 3. In western medicine, causes that trigger hip joint pain are trauma, fracture, dislocation,and bacterial infection. 4. Treatment of hip joint disorder in western medicine, physiotherapy concerning conservative treatment, and pain control with drug treatment, kinesitherapy are used, and concernig fracture, operation is used. 5. In Eastern medicine, principle of treating hip joint pain, sung-juk-sa-ji(盛則寫之), hu-juk-bo-ji(虛則補之), yul-juk-jil-ji(熱則疾之), han-juk-yu-ji(寒則留之), ham-ha-juk-chim-ji(陷下則沈之), bul-sung-bul-hu(不盛不虛), yi-kyong-chui-ji(以經取之) is presented. This priciple of treatment was descended through ages and is now applied to treatments such as Acupuncture, Herbal, physical treatment based on so-san-eo-hyul(消散瘀血), seo-kun-tong-rak(舒筋通絡), so-ri-kwan-jul(疏利關節) principle. 6. In Eastern medicine, meridians used to treat hip joint pain are The Chok yangmyung wi Kyong(足陽明胃經), Chok taeum bi Kyong(足太陰脾經), Chock soyang dam Kyong(足少陽膽經), Chock guelum gan Kyong(足厥陰肝經). In conclusion, hip joint pain should be considered in relationship with internal organs and whole body system. Western & Eastern point of view should be carefully inspected and connected and intensive study of nervous system and meridian is required, in order to adopt best treatment for the patients.

  • The CM247LC, a Ni-based superalloy material used for gas turbine hot gas path parts, is casted using directionally solidified technology to analyze the mechanical properties and microstructures through HIP (Hot Isostatic Pressing) and post-heat treatment, and to derive optimal HIP treatment conditions. The CM247LC material is being researched in various ways as an alternative material for prototyping gas turbine blades. In particular, the blade rotating part is exposed and operated in a high temperature and high-pressure environment, and when damaged, it may cause huge economic losses. Therefore, in order to use the CM247LC material as prototyping materials for gas turbine blades, the reliability of the microstructure and mechanical properties must be verified. In this study, after casting rod test specimens using CM247LC material by directionally solidified technology, after that the specimens were performed by HIP treatment and post-heat treatment to test two HIP conditions designed by KEPCO to derive the possibility of prototyping of CM247LC material and optimization of HIP treatment conditions. Additionally, the properties of CM247LC material were compared to the GTD111DS material using for 1,300℃ class gas turbine blades.

  • Purpose: This study was undertaken in order to identify the characteristics of patients diagnosed with occult an hip fracture after hip trauma. Methods: We retrospectively reviewed the medical records and radiology reports of all patients who underwent hip skeletal computed tomography (CT) for suspected hip fractures but had normal initial X-rays after hip trauma between August 2006 and January 2012. The variables evaluated included age, gender, body mass index (BMI), accident mechanism, previous fracture, independence, late presentation, ability to bear weight, pain on passive rotation, tenderness of the groin area, diagnosis and treatment. Patients were divided into two groups, with hip fracture (occult hip fracture group) and without hip fracture (no fracture group) to evaluate the characteristics associated with an occult hip fracture. Results: The patients, a total of 139, had a mean age of 58.3 years and included 72 male patients(51.8%). The occult hip fracture group included 43 patients(30.9%). Of those 43, 21 patients(48.8%) had intertrochanteric or trochanteric fractures, 8 patients(18.6%) had femur neck fractures and 14 patients(32.6%) had acetabular fractures. Of the 43, 15 patients(34.9%) needed operative treatment. Age was higher in the occult hip fracture group than it was in the no fracture group($64.4{\pm}19.1$ years vs. $55.5{\pm}23.6$ years, p=0.021). A previous fracture was associated with the presence of a new fracture (p=0.014; OR=3.971, 95% CI=1.314-11.997). Conclusion: Further evaluation of patients who are older or have history of fractures is prudent, even though the initial X-rays are normal.

  • One of the main purposes in the treatment of developmental dislocation of the hip is to achieve and maintain concentric, congruent, and stable reduction. The arthrogram performs an important role in the diagnosis and treatment of developmental dislocation of the hip. The arthrogram provides much information about the soft tissue status of the hip joint. Limbus and ligamentum teres is exactly evaluated so that we can plan the reduction and treatment before operation. Eighteen preoperative hip arthrograms of 17 children treated for developmental dislocation of the hip from 1992 to 1998 were reviewed. The limbus, ligamentum teres and transverse acetabular ligament were compared with the pathoanatomy seen at the time of open reduction. Arthrography proved to be reliable in identifying the limbus and ligamentum teres. So we recommend that arthrography must be performed before closed or open reduction. Also, we recorded the radiographic parameters: acetabular index, acetabular floor thickness, center edge(CE) angle of Wiberg, and Y-coordinate. The center edge(CE) angle of Wiberg obtained from arthrography was measured more accurately than from simple roentgenograms because the ossification of the femoral head was frequently located eccentrically in the developmental dislocation of the hip.

  • A study has been made to investigate the effects of hot isostatic pressing(HIPing) on the microstructure and high temperature fatigue lives of the IN738LC, Ni-base superalloy used in turbine blades, with emphasis on the elimination of casting microporosity and fatigue damage through HIP treatments. Microstructure was observed using OM, SEM and the fatigue life was investigated with rotate bending fatigue tester. The results show that the fatigue lives of properly HIP-processed specimens could be extended be extended by a factor of about sixty. In contrast, no comparable life improvement was achieved with heat treatment only. The repetitive HIP treatment was shown to be very effective as a means of rejuvenating the fatigue life of intentionally fatigue-damaged IN738LC by restoration of the initial alloy microstructure and additional removal of fine casting defects which remained in the HIP-processed material.
